Restore the "lost password" link on the login page.
Improve error handling for geocoding
Bugfix : account creation was not working
Sitemap bugfix
Refactor logon.php for AJAX support and modular error handling
Implement secure passwordless login via email magic link
Refactored anti-CSRF code
Updated doc
Typo fix + adding the required tables for the fulltext search engine
Improve documentation with README.md, SECURITY.md and DEVELOPER.md
Bugfix in user services display
- bugfix : avoid double submit on birth date change
- adding capability to edit the household fixed line phone number
- bugfix : date entry for the birthday in profile
Upgrade TinyMCE from 5.x to 7.x
Add error handler for errors generated client-side.
Bugfix : filename validator was too strict and did not allow for space in filenames
Add email and household ID to profile page
Restored the service editing feature inside the profile
- make JavaScript modular
White spaces in uploaded files
Ignore /fm/ directory
Update components
Improve file access with public and private stores
Get rid of create_function() for PHP>7.2 compatibility
iapc_* is deprecated in PHP8 in favour of apcu_*
Class definitions in PHP8 requires the __construct() function as constructor
add missing bootstrap-functions.tpl
New logbook system operational (including admin mode)
New logbook encoding logic based on simpleCRUD
Bug fix lost password process
Misc updates and fixes
Allow official communications
Removal of the no-cookie button for a more discrete menu line
Rewording and button-styling of the menu
Add user review page
Fix inconsistent session management behaviour by moving out configuration to dedicated object
Use bootstrap cards for messages on homepage
Improving transaction recording form
Get rid of household-linked services
Hardening the file manager (get rid of direct object references)
Bootstrapization Edit page
Bootstrapization for email sending
Accept transactions with zero duration
Bugfix when there is a valid household with id "0"
French typo
Small correction of terms
Fix fulltext searching
Bugfix : make transactions possible for non-admin users
Misc cleanup
FIrest re-implementation of service interface (user based)
Bug fixes transaction admin interface
Review/improve transaction logic
Introduce the concept of invisible households, for pseudo-accounts
New transaction logbook logic and admin interface
Bootstrapization of calendar.php
Bug fix : could not delete hh member if still referenced in DB
Bootstrapization of admin_pages.php
Add birth date to contact information
Upgrade composer. Include e.a. fontawsome
Don't allow access if houshold is de-activated
iDelete fleamarket entries on household deletion
Fix sentence
Bootstrapization of profile page
Suspend household
fixed in r297
Disconnection doesn't work for persistent logins
fixed in r298
Bugfix: random family was picked up in deleted records
Delete persistent cookie on logout
Bug fixe : delete household didn't work
Upgrade phpspreadsheet
iAdd support to store .eml files
Suspend household
Add birth date field to system
Disconnection doesn't work for persistent logins
Fix regression on households_list
Fine tune admin_households following initial tester remarks
Make accounting and inter-lets mgt optional
Updated members report to include email and mobile
Migrated admin-households to Bootstrap
Calendar migrated to Bootstrap
Households-list migrated to Bootstrap
Enable Bootstrap for all pages
Upgrade find_services to bootstrap
Allow more file types in file manager
Some tuning for better display on mobile devices
Restored error messages on home page under bootstrap modal logic
Restored Terms-of-use agreement display and recording
Fix regression
Streamlined the transaction encoding form.
Re-implement transaction system in Bootstrap mode
installation issue, supported_languages function missing
The installer subsystem is broken. Same goes for the multi-language system. Current system is mostly hardcoded in french, with no viable installer. Best workaround for now is to install DB manually (DB schema in install/db-creation.sql should be up to date).
installation issue, supported_languages function missing
Remove service catalg management
Bugfix on login form
Migrate home page, login form and associated messages to bootstrap
Adding bootstrap
Placeholder picture for flea market